 <title>JetBlue Will Refund Tickets For Laid Off Workers</title>
 <link>http://www.savvysugar.com/JetBlue-Refund-Tickets-Laid-Off-Workers-2826619</link>
 <description>&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.savvysugar.com/JetBlue-Refund-Tickets-Laid-Off-Workers-2826619&quot;&gt;&lt;img  width=136 height=160  src=&#039;http://media.onsugar.com/files/upl2/10/104165/08_2009/965ba3ee8c4b5f44_jetblue.large.jpg&#039;&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;span class=&quot;inline left&quot;&gt;&lt;/span&gt;So many people could use a helping hand these days, and JetBlue is stepping up to lend one to weary, would-be travelers. If you&#039;ve flown with the airline with more legroom then you may recall its tickets are typically not refundable. In a business-minded gesture, &lt;a href=&quot;http://news.yahoo.com/s/ap_travel/20090217/ap_tr_ge/travel_brief_jetblue_customer_promise;_ylt=Aj_Cwky2ZTboA4z49AM8dO88sM0F&quot; onclick=&#039;trackOutboundLink(&quot;/outgoing/news.yahoo.com/s/ap_travel/20090217/ap_tr_ge/travel_brief_jetblue_customer_promise;_ylt=Aj_Cwky2ZTboA4z49AM8dO88sM0F&quot;, &quot;&quot;); return true;&#039;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;JetBlue has announced it will refund&lt;/a&gt; the tickets of anyone who made a purchase before losing their job as part of The JetBlue Promise Program.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The airline is hoping its increased flexibility will encourage people to book tickets during this uncertain economic time. If you lose your job after Feb. 17 and booked your flight between Feb.1 and June 1, you&#039;re eligible to receive a full refund for your JetBlue reservation. The request must be submitted at least two weeks before your scheduled departure date. Do you think the policy will work out for JetBlue?  &lt;/p&gt;

 <title>JetBlue Is the Most-Delayed Airline</title>
 <link>http://www.savvysugar.com/JetBlue-Most-Delayed-Airline-1919397</link>
 <description>&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.savvysugar.com/JetBlue-Most-Delayed-Airline-1919397&quot;&gt;&lt;img  width=160 height=104  src=&#039;http://media.onsugar.com/files/upl1/10/104165/36_2008/delay.large.jpg&#039;&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;p&gt;JetBlue&#039;s CEO may have shown his employees that he&#039;s a stand-up guy &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.savvysugar.com/1822693/&quot; &gt;by voluntarily cutting his salary&lt;/a&gt;, but the executives of the airline could probably save more money by figuring out a plan for greater efficiency. Research shows that JetBlue was &lt;a href=&quot;http://money.cnn.com/2008/09/04/news/economy/airline_delays/index.htm/&quot; onclick=&#039;trackOutboundLink(&quot;/outgoing/money.cnn.com/2008/09/04/news/economy/airline_delays/index.htm/&quot;, &quot;&quot;); return true;&#039;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;the most-delayed major airline&lt;/a&gt; in August, with an on-time arrival rate of 64.7 percent, while the industry average for being on-time was 77.3 percent.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span class=&quot;inline left&quot;&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;With that kind of failing record, some passengers may be more likely to seek out seats on other airlines. Northwest&#039;s on-time arrival record of 85.3 percent outshines JetBlue&#039;s August performance, and its punctuality made Northwest the top performer, timing-wise. As for regional carriers, Hawaiian Airlines&#039; 91 percent on-time arrival record makes me want to put on a lei and say aloha! &lt;/p&gt;

 <title>The Scoop: JetBlue Doubles Prices for Underseat Pets</title>
 <link>http://www.petsugar.com/Scoop-JetBlue-Doubles-Prices-Underseat-Pets-1645796</link>
 <description>&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.petsugar.com/Scoop-JetBlue-Doubles-Prices-Underseat-Pets-1645796&quot;&gt;&lt;img  width=160 height=107  src=&#039;http://media.onsugar.com/files/upl1/10/104166/21_2008/jetblue.large.jpg&#039;&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;span class=&quot;inline left&quot;&gt;&lt;/span&gt;All this talk of &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.savvysugar.com/1641825&quot; &gt;what the airlines are charging for the details&lt;/a&gt;, got me thinking about my lil detail, &lt;a href=&quot;http://teamsugar.com/pet/716881&quot; &gt;North&lt;/a&gt;. He loves being included in my life – &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.petsugar.com/1640226&quot; &gt;and lets me know when he doesn&#039;t feel that way&lt;/a&gt; – but, boy, can the price of plane tickets get us down! When looking into a summer trip with my pooch this week, I realized a very shocking (and troubling) fact: &lt;a href=&quot;http://help.jetblue.com/SRVS/CGI-BIN/webisapi.dll/,/?St=51,E=0000000000015216437,K=5613,Sxi=13,Case=obj(2032)&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;JetBlue&lt;/a&gt; has &lt;i&gt;doubled&lt;/i&gt; the price of a cabin pet from $50 to $100. I spoke with a representative from the airline&#039;s corporate communications department who shared some information on this change. Learn what I found out when you read more.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;On May 1, 2008, the nonrefundable fee for a high-flying pet became $100 each way. This airline still only allows small pets – weighing up to 20 pounds inside a carrier – to travel under the seat counting as your &quot;personal item.&quot; The price change was part of an effort to combat the continual rise in the cost of operation – I was told that a lot of thought was put into this decision, and it could be considered a last resort as the industry is encountering a unique environment because of the price of fuel these days.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The news hits pretty hard, especially considering this airline is known for having some of the lowest one-way fares around – $100 each way could very well put your pet&#039;s ticket cost &lt;i&gt;over&lt;/i&gt; that of your own! I can definitely understand bringing a doggie or kitty onboard for a &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.petsugar.com/882632&quot; &gt;big holiday or important trip&lt;/a&gt;, but this price point makes it often cheaper and easier to keep pets grounded at a &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.petsugar.com/tag/wag+hotels&quot; &gt;fab boarding facility&lt;/a&gt; instead.
